Former I-T commissioner from Mumbai gets 4 years jail in bribery case

July 28, 2018 1533 Views 0 comment Print

The Special Judge for CBI Cases, Mumbai has convicted Shri Dayashankar, the then Commissioner Income Tax (Appeals), Bandra Kurla Complex, Mumbai and sentenced him to undergo 04 years Rigorous Imprisonment with fine of Rs.2,50,000/- in a bribery case.

Time & cost involved in tax compliance to reduce dramatically: CBIC Chairman

July 27, 2018 972 Views 0 comment Print

The 28th meeting of the GST Council was held on 21st July, 2018. Several important and consumer friendly decisions have been taken in the meeting. The time and cost involved in tax compliance has also been dramatically reduced by enabling businesses with an annual turnover of up to Rs. 5 Crore to file quarterly returns, in lieu of monthly returns, along with the simplification of the return format itself. MCA to update KYC of Directors | New E-form DIR-3 KYC notified

July 27, 2018 10713 Views 1 comment Print

The following points to be taken into account as per DIR-3 KYC for providing details and information: Every Director who has been allotted DIN on or before 31st March, 2018 and whose DIN status is ‘Approved’ would be mandatorily required to file form DIR-3 KYC.

DGFT allows free Import of Urea with Actual User Condition

July 27, 2018 1410 Views 0 comment Print

DGFT amends Import Policy of Urea to allow free Import of Urea of industrial/non- agricultural/technical grade with Actual User Condition vide Notification No. 23/2015-2020 Dated: 27 July, 2018.
